The low-energy data are dominated by the S11 wave which has two poles in the energy region below 2 GeV. Eleven nucleon resonances are observed in their decay into p eta. At medium energies we find evidence for a new resonance N(2070)D15 with (mass, width) = (2068+-22, 295+-40) MeV. At photon energies above 1.5 GeV, a strong peak in forward direction develops, signalling the exchange of vector mesons in the t channel."},"verification_status":{"content_addressed":true,"pith_receipt":true,"author_attested":false,"weak_author_claims":0,"strong_author_claims":0,"externally_anchored":false,"storage_verified":false,"citation_signatures":0,"replication_records":0,"graph_snapshot":true,"references_resolved":false,"formal_links_present":false},"canonical_record":{"source":{"id":"hep-ex/0311045","kind":"arxiv","version":4},"metadata":{"license":"","primary_cat":"hep-ex","submitted_at":"2003-11-21T11:37:54Z","cross_cats_sorted":[],"title_canon_sha256":"b4f5c4407adde8d356ab95f5ac3545ffb3964b708c4eb790c9812d8cbbf69a9a","abstract_canon_sha256":"4ae708c6061e864346497aec3bed17bb373d74fed5773c6bb36f5b0c03f1f85e"},"schema_version":"1.0"},"receipt":{"kind":"pith_receipt","key_id":"pith-v1-2026-05","algorithm":"ed25519","signed_at":"2026-07-04T23:55:50.319927Z","signature_b64":"CLkaQ6hWQ1rN7TBopPOJLEJD1dYFCov3rL4EWRoxNjB8fB74mnKSo7qd3qe3I/1Q5qJMHuUu1N9eL2wu9Qs2Bg==","signed_message":"canonical_sha256_bytes","builder_version":"pith-number-builder-2026-05-17-v1","receipt_version":"0.3","canonical_sha256":"eeb0976706e3bf1cfd8ef036f764b894f4b8a0df6d258672e03c83fcd54daccb","last_reissued_at":"2026-07-04T23:55:50.319484Z","signature_status":"signed_v1","first_computed_at":"2026-07-04T23:55:50.319484Z","public_key_fingerprint":"8d4b5ee74e4693bcd1df2446408b0d54"},"graph_snapshot":{"paper":{"title":"Photoproduction of eta mesons off protons for photon energies from 0.75 GeV to 3 GeV","license":"","headline":"","cross_cats":[],"primary_cat":"hep-ex","authors_text":"Olivia Bartholomy (for the CB-ELSA Collaboration), Volker Crede","submitted_at":"2003-11-21T11:37:54Z","abstract_excerpt":"Total and differential cross sections for the reaction p(gamma, eta)p have been measured for photon energies in the range from 750 MeV to 3 GeV.
